Elevating Performance Through ERP in Australia's Service Industry
The dynamic services sector in Australia is constantly seeking ways to improve efficiency and profitability. Enter Enterprise Resource Planning (ERP) systems, a comprehensive solution designed to streamline operations and accelerate growth. By integrating an ERP system, service businesses are able to gain substantial insights into their activities, leading to improved resource allocation, minimized operational costs, and ultimately, a boosted bottom line.
- Additionally, ERP systems support better collaboration between departments, leading to optimized communication and quicker decision-making.
- Specifically, an ERP system can optimize tasks such as invoicing, payroll, and customer relationship management (CRM), freeing up valuable staff time for more strategic initiatives.
- Therefore, service businesses in Australia are increasingly implementing ERP solutions to stay at the forefront of their industry.

The Future of Service Management: How ERP is Shaping the Landscape in Australia
Service management plays a crucial role in driving business success across numerous industries in Australia. Traditionally, service management has relied on disparate systems, often leading to siloed operations. However, the emergence of Enterprise Resource Planning (ERP) systems is rapidly changing the landscape.
By integrating core business processes, ERP empowers organizations to achieve optimized service delivery, reduce costs, and gain a operational edge. A key advantage of ERP in service management is its capability to provide a unified view of customer interactions, enabling organizations to deliver tailored service experiences.
Furthermore, ERP's automation capabilities can streamline routine tasks, releasing resources for more strategic initiatives.
